带头结点的单链表head为空的条件是()。
设某带头结头的单链表的结点结构说明如下:typedef struct nodel{int data struct nodel*next;}node;试设计一个算法:void copy(node*headl,node*head2),将以head1为头指针的单链表复制到一个不带有头结点且以head2为头指针的单链表中。
若要将一个单链表中的元素倒置,可以借助()建立单链表的思想将链表中的结点重新放置。
带头结点的单链表first为空的判定条件是()。
带头结点的单链表head为空的判定条件是()。
在单链表中插入结点只需要()。但同时,若要在第( )个结点之前插入元素,修改的是第 ( )个结点的指针。
带头结点的单链表L为空的判定条件是 。
带头结点head的单链表为空的判定条件是( )
7. 对于一个头指针为head的带头结点的单链表,判定该表为空表的条件是()。
不带头结点的单链表head为空的判定条件是____
●带头结点的单链表head为空的判断条件是 ()。()
已知一个不带头结点单链表的头指针为L,则在表头元素前插入新结点*s的语句为()
2、在一个带头结点的单链表中,若 head 所指结点是头结点,若要删除第一个实际元素结点,则执行()。
【单选题】7. 用带头结点的单链表表示队长大于1的队列时,其队头指针指向队头结点,其队尾指针指向队尾结点,则在进行删除操作时()。
有一个由整数元素构成的非空单链表A,设计一个算法,将其拆分成两个单链表A和B,使得A单链表中含有所有的偶数结点,B单链表中含有所有的奇数结点,且保持原来的相对次序。
【EX-3-4】在以下几种存储结构中,哪个最适合用作链栈? (1)带头结点的单链表 (2)不带头结点的循环单链表 (3)带头结点的双链表。
【2-1-4】以下关于单链表的叙述中,不正确的是()。 A.结点除自身信息外还包括指针域,因此存储密度小于顺序存储结构 B.逻辑上相邻的元素物理上不必相邻 C.可以通过头结点直接计算第i个结点的存储地址 D.插入、删除运算操作方便,不必移动结点
带头结点的单链表head为空的判定条件是()
13、以下算法是删除带头结点单链表L中的最小的元素,横线处应填入的语句是()。 void DelMinNode(LinkList L) { p=L->next; pre=L; if(L==NULL) return; while(p->next!=NULL) //pre指向最小元素的前驱元素,开始默认第一个结点最小,pre指向头结点 { if(p->next->data < pre->next->data) pre=p; } //删除pre后面的结点 p=pre->next; ; }
12、不带头结点的单链表head为空的判定条件是()。
22、从一个不带头结点的单链表Ist表示的链栈中删除一个结点,用α保存被删结点的值,应执行
2、用不带头结点的单链表存储队列时,其队头指针指向队头结点,其队尾指针指向队尾结点,则在进行删除操作时
48、若用不带头结点的单链表来存储链栈lst,则创建一个空栈所要执行的操作是
头指针为head的带头结点的单链表为空的判定条件是()